FIVE times the Trouble — When Trouble the black cat detective is on the case, mystery, mayhem, and a little romance are only a whisker away.Sleek, black and sometimes snarky, Trouble is the son of Familiar, another famous black cat detective, and fancies himself a feline Sherlock Holmes (the Benedict Cumberbatch version).Trouble thinks with a slight British accentand has one big attitude. He's far smarter than the bipeds he helps with solving mysteries involving art thieves, arsonists, and murderers. And he's more than astute in the ways of the humanoid heart.DiscoverTrouble in this boxed collection of the first five books in the series.Join writers Carolyn Haines, Rebecca Barret, Claire Matturro, Susan Y. Tanner, and Laura Benedict for five complete mysteriesand a lot of fun with a wise-cracking kitty. To meet Trouble is to love himunless you're the villain.
